America Past And Present by Robert A. Divine, T. H. Breen, R. Hal Williams, Ariela J. Gross, H. W. Brands

In America Past and Present, Divine, Breen, Williams, Gross, and Brands explore the country’s past from pre-colonial times to the present day. The book is divided into nine parts, each of which covers a different time period in American history. In the first part, the authors discuss the Native American peoples who inhabited the land before Europeans arrived.

They describe how these groups lived and interacted with one another, as well as the impact that European colonization had on them. The second part focuses on the colonial period, discussing the reasons why Europeans came to America and how they established their settlements. The third part covers the American Revolution and its aftermath, while the fourth part looks at the early years of the republic.

The fifth part discusses westward expansion and Manifest Destiny in nineteenth-century America. The Civil War and Reconstruction are covered in detail in sixth part. In seventh section, which looks at late-nineteenth-century America, topics such as industrialization, urbanization, immigration, and reform are discussed.

The eighth part focuses on twentieth-century America up to World War II.

What are the Three Most Important Factors That Have Shaped America’S History

The three most important factors that have shaped America’s history are geography, immigration, and religion. Geography has played a significant role in America’s history. The country’s vast size and variety of landscapes has allowed for a wide range of settlement patterns and economic activities.

Additionally, the country’s location between Europe and Asia has made it a crossroads for trade and cultural exchange. America’shistory is also deeply intertwined with immigration. The United States has always been a destination for people seeking new opportunities and freedoms.

Immigrants have brought their own cultures and traditions to the country, which have helped shape American society. Religion has also played a significant role in American history. Various religious groups have played an important role in the country’s founding, settlement, and development.

How Did the American Revolution Change the Country And Its People

The American Revolution was a turning point in American history, marking the country’s independence from Great Britain. The war had a profound impact on the nation and its people, transforming them in many ways. One of the most significant changes was the shift in power from the British monarchy to the new American government.

The Revolution also brought about greater equality for all Americans, as well as more political and economic freedom. These changes helped to forge a new national identity for the United States. The Revolution also had a lasting impact on America’s relationship with the rest of the world.

Prior to the war, most Americans saw themselves as British citizens living in North America. Afterward, they began to view themselves as Americans first and foremost. This newfound sense of nationalism would shape the country’s foreign policy for years to come.

What were Some of the Key Events And Ideas During the Civil War Era

There were a number of key events and ideas during the Civil War era. One of the key events was the Battle of Gettysburg, which was a turning point in the war. The Union army was able to defeat the Confederate army, and this led to the eventual Union victory.

Another key event was Abraham Lincoln’s Emancipation Proclamation, which freed all slaves in the Confederacy. This helped to turn public opinion against slavery, and it also increased support for the Union cause. Finally, one of the key ideas during this time period was that of states’ rights.

The Confederacy believed that each state had the right to secede from the United States, while the Union believed that secession was illegal. This disagreement led to war.
